## Vendoring Third-Party Fonts

Quick heads-up before you touch the asset pipeline: we don't hotlink fonts at Thistledown, ever. All third-party typefaces get vendored through the Glyphbox service, which checks the license terms, strips unused glyph ranges, and pins an immutable copy in our asset store. Your build then references that pinned copy, so nothing breaks when an upstream foundry moves files around. To register a new font family, call the Glyphbox intake endpoint with the contractor key below.

service key, fawip-bajef: kto11_Qt5wZK9vdNC

### Scanner returns HTTP 401 on every scan

When the Orvex handheld scanner posts decoded barcodes to the Pellan inventory bridge, a 401 usually means the device clock has drifted beyond the signature window. Verify NTP sync on the dock station in the Harwick warehouse build, then confirm the bridge is addressed over TLS only. For manual replay of a failed scan, authenticate with the credential below.

session JWT of yawep-yawep = eyJhbGciOiJIUzI1NiIsInR5cCI6IkpXVCJ9.eyJzdWIiOiI3pWF3_In0.aXYsHiog

Ticket: SDK-588 — Parity test harness blocked by expired credentials

The nightly parity suite comparing the Kestrel Java and Swift SDKs has been failing since Monday. Root cause is an expired credential for the comparison service, not an actual behavioral divergence — both SDKs pass individually. Until rotation completes, parity reports for the eng sync will show stale data. The newly issued key for the comparison service follows below.

gateway credential: kto3_qfe

**Mgmt Meeting Minutes — Retiring the Brightline Range**

Quick recap for sales leads at Fenholt Supplies: we agreed to retire the Brightline fixture range by year-end. Remaining stock moves to clearance pricing next month, and accounts on standing orders get migrated to the Lumetta range. Trade-in incentives were approved in principle. The confidential note on next steps sits just below.

board note of bajof-bajeg: The pricing group signed off on a budget of $13.4 million for Project Sildor. The renewal with Lamixek Holdings closes at $48.9 million a year, 49 percent above the last contract.